The accrued fabric or layout of a city is a kind of DNA, from which structures and qualities, developments and ruptures can be deduced. In his research in the context of the applied arts and sciences university, Quintus Miller investigates the transformation of the city, and as architect, with his buildings intervenes in the urban structure. As architectural historian and publicist, Dorothee Huber is especially familiar with the urban development of Basel.
